Little Rock Pharmacist Jobs Overview
Pharmacist jobs keep the healthcare cycle going by safely providing prescriptions to the population. But the role of pharmacists has evolved into something bigger—a community-oriented wellness vocation, encompassing everything from delivering vaccines and offering all-inclusive medication management to recommending healthy lifestyle tips. Community accessibility has become the pharmacist's hallmark: According to the National Center for Chronic Disease Prevention and Health Promotion, close to nine in 10 Americans live within five miles of a pharmacy.
If you have a keen interest in science, the ability to effectively multitask, and a passion for healthcare, then a pharmacist job may be for you. Some roles in the pharmacology field involve less patient and community interaction, but generally, your duties will include preparing and dispensing medications judiciously, monitoring updates or changes in drug therapies, and advising patients about how to take medicines. Besides supervising what medications are given to patients, pharmacists are becoming more ingrained within the patient-care fabric, performing tasks that make better use of their full capabilities, such as coordinating with doctors on antibiotic selection and blood-sugar or cholesterol testing.

About Working in Little Rock, Arkansas
The capital of Arkansas, Little Rock has a plethora of offerings in art, culture, and learning, from the Museum of Discovery for science-and-technology enthusiasts to the reconceived Arkansas Arts Center—the state's biggest cultural institution. If you're a gastronome who relishes discovering foods from around the world, you'll love the area's variety of ethnic restaurants (it was previously named one of Forbes Travel Guide's "secret foodie cities"). Though Little Rock jobs veer toward government services, there are many opportunities in business, marketing, retail, and healthcare too, with one of the largest employers being the University of Arkansas for Medical Sciences (UAMS).
Speaking of formidable, Little Rock is also home to the 17-acre Clinton Presidential Center, featuring one of the largest presidential libraries (and accompanying archives) in the nation. Plus, there's the dignified Old State House Museum (a premier example of Doric architecture); the State Capitol (a grand structure based on the design of the U.S. Capitol in D.C.); Pinnacle Mountain State Park for hiking, fishing, and bird-watching; and the River Market district for shopping and live music. Despite all these amenities and attractions, Little Rock's cost of living is still 17.5% lower than the U.S. average. Update Your Little Rock Pharmacist Resume
Your pharmacist resume should highlight any relevant research you may have already conducted and specialty areas you'd like to underline (for instance, critical-care pharmaceuticals). On top of that, you should showcase your communication skills (since pharmacists need to interact with everyone from doctors and nurses to technicians and patients) and a flair for counseling (to ensure medicines are correctly administered).
